Chicken & Wild Rice Soup: A Cozy, Comforting Classic
When the weather turns chilly, there’s nothing quite like a warm bowl of soup to soothe the soul. This Chicken & Wild Rice Soup is a perfect choice for cozying up on a cold day, packed with tender chicken, earthy wild rice, and a flavorful blend of veggies. Creamy and comforting, this soup is simple to make and hearty enough to serve as a meal. With wholesome ingredients and a rich, satisfying flavor, it’s sure to become a family favorite!
Ingredients
- 1 lb boneless, skinless chicken breasts (or thighs), diced
- 1 cup wild rice, uncooked
- 1 tbsp olive oil
- 1 onion, finely chopped
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 2 carrots, diced
- 2 celery stalks, diced
- 6 cups chicken broth
- 1 cup heavy cream (or half-and-half for a lighter option)
- 1 tsp dried thyme
- 1 tsp dried rosemary
- Salt and pepper, to taste
- Fresh parsley, for garnish (optional)
